Resolving dependencies... Starting IfElse-0.85 Starting SafeSemaphore-0.10.1 Starting Only-0.1 Starting StateVar-1.2.2 Building IfElse-0.85 Building Only-0.1 Building SafeSemaphore-0.10.1 Building StateVar-1.2.2 Completed IfElse-0.85 Starting appar-0.1.8 Completed Only-0.1 Starting auto-update-0.1.6 Building appar-0.1.8 Completed StateVar-1.2.2 Starting base-compat-0.12.1 Building auto-update-0.1.6 Building base-compat-0.12.1 Completed appar-0.1.8 Starting base-orphans-0.8.6 Completed SafeSemaphore-0.10.1 Starting base16-bytestring-1.0.2.0 Building base-orphans-0.8.6 Completed auto-update-0.1.6 Starting base64-bytestring-1.2.1.0 Building base16-bytestring-1.0.2.0 Building base64-bytestring-1.2.1.0 Completed base16-bytestring-1.0.2.0 Starting basement-0.0.14 Building basement-0.0.14 Completed base64-bytestring-1.2.1.0 Starting blaze-builder-0.4.2.2 Building blaze-builder-0.4.2.2 Completed base-compat-0.12.1 Starting bloomfilter-2.0.1.0 Building bloomfilter-2.0.1.0 Completed base-orphans-0.8.6 Starting bsb-http-chunked-0.0.0.4 Building bsb-http-chunked-0.0.0.4 Completed blaze-builder-0.4.2.2 Starting byteable-0.1.1 Completed bsb-http-chunked-0.0.0.4 Starting byteorder-1.0.4 Building byteable-0.1.1 Building byteorder-1.0.4 Completed bloomfilter-2.0.1.0 Starting cabal-doctest-1.0.9 Building cabal-doctest-1.0.9 Completed byteable-0.1.1 Starting call-stack-0.4.0 Completed byteorder-1.0.4 Starting cereal-0.5.8.2 Building call-stack-0.4.0 Building cereal-0.5.8.2 Completed call-stack-0.4.0 Starting clock-0.8.3 Building clock-0.8.3 Completed cabal-doctest-1.0.9 Starting code-page-0.2.1 Building code-page-0.2.1 Completed clock-0.8.3 Starting colour-2.3.6 Completed code-page-0.2.1 Starting cryptohash-md5-0.11.101.0 Building colour-2.3.6 Building cryptohash-md5-0.11.101.0 Completed cereal-0.5.8.2 Starting cryptohash-sha1-0.11.101.0 Completed cryptohash-md5-0.11.101.0 Starting data-default-class-0.1.2.0 Building cryptohash-sha1-0.11.101.0 Building data-default-class-0.1.2.0 Completed data-default-class-0.1.2.0 Starting disk-free-space-0.1.0.1 Building disk-free-space-0.1.0.1 Completed cryptohash-sha1-0.11.101.0 Starting dlist-1.0 Completed disk-free-space-0.1.0.1 Starting easy-file-0.2.2 Building dlist-1.0 Completed colour-2.3.6 Starting entropy-0.4.1.7 Building easy-file-0.2.2 Completed easy-file-0.2.2 Starting file-embed-0.0.15.0 Building entropy-0.4.1.7 Building file-embed-0.0.15.0 Completed dlist-1.0 Starting filepath-bytestring-1.4.2.1.9 Building filepath-bytestring-1.4.2.1.9 Completed file-embed-0.0.15.0 Starting hashable-1.3.5.0 Building hashable-1.3.5.0 Completed entropy-0.4.1.7 Starting hourglass-0.2.12 Completed filepath-bytestring-1.4.2.1.9 Starting indexed-traversable-0.1.2 Building hourglass-0.2.12 Building indexed-traversable-0.1.2 Completed hashable-1.3.5.0 Starting integer-logarithms-1.0.3.1 Building integer-logarithms-1.0.3.1 Completed integer-logarithms-1.0.3.1 Starting js-chart-2.9.4.1 Completed indexed-traversable-0.1.2 Starting lift-type-0.1.0.1 Building js-chart-2.9.4.1 Building lift-type-0.1.0.1 Completed js-chart-2.9.4.1 Starting magic-1.1 Completed lift-type-0.1.0.1 Starting microlens-0.4.13.0 Failed to install magic-1.1 Build log ( /home/builder/.cabal/logs/ghc-8.10.2/magic-1.1-1RoyXuVqQ6zBGAsTPFSblk.log ): cabal: Entering directory '/tmp/cabal-tmp-6091/magic-1.1' Configuring magic-1.1... cabal: Missing dependency on a foreign library: * Missing (or bad) C library: magic This problem can usually be solved by installing the system package that provides this library (you may need the "-dev" version). If the library is already installed but in a non-standard location then you can use the flags --extra-include-dirs= and --extra-lib-dirs= to specify where it is.If the library file does exist, it may contain errors that are caught by the C compiler at the preprocessing stage. In this case you can re-run configure with the verbosity flag -v3 to see the error messages. cabal: Leaving directory '/tmp/cabal-tmp-6091/magic-1.1' Starting mime-types-0.1.0.9 Building microlens-0.4.13.0 Completed hourglass-0.2.12 Building mime-types-0.1.0.9 Completed microlens-0.4.13.0 Completed basement-0.0.14 Completed mime-types-0.1.0.9 cabal: Error: some packages failed to install: git-annex-10.20220623-IejXl89puu33I06sDWAO8T depends on git-annex-10.20220623 which failed to install. magic-1.1-1RoyXuVqQ6zBGAsTPFSblk failed during the configure step. The exception was: ExitFailure 1